Output 3094672f6fbac5f51ccd6a722e596fe02c18da334a1c7c8de459e4fd8c04b907:468

value
4513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ecab03c166d72fbf9e29566307972ee12068aa59430a9a7d28f182e589f102a6
address
bc1paj4s8stx6uhml83f2e3s09ewuysx32jegv9f5lfg7xpwtz03q2nqmc49j5
transaction
3094672f6fbac5f51ccd6a722e596fe02c18da334a1c7c8de459e4fd8c04b907
confirmations
85374
spent
true